The first recommend ingredient is Natural Vitamin E. The benefits of Vitamin E for the health of the skins are well proven. This is due to its antioxidant properties. It has been shown in many scientific studies to play a vital role in lightening the appearance of freckles, dark spots and stretch marks on the skin.
The second recommended ingredient is Nutgrass Root. Recent research has shown that Nutgrass Root can lighten skin naturally and reducing freckles without any harmful side effect. This is due to its ability to inhibit the formation of the skin pigment melanin. Hence, if you want to reduce the appearance of freckles on your face naturally, then look out for whitening product with Nutgrass Root.
The other ingredient that you can not miss is Grape seed oil. Grape seed oil is rich in Vitamin E and linoleic acid and several other essential oils which are necessary for skin health. Many scientific studies have shown it is effective for skin repairing and freckles removing on face.
